比特币作为一种去中心化的数字货币,依赖于区块链技术来维持其安全性和透明度。在这个过程中,比特币钱包起着至关重要的作用,尤其是其生成算法。钱包生成算法是用于创建和管理比特币地址和私钥的核心技术,它关系到持有者的数字资产安全,确保其私钥不被破解,同时还能在网络中生成合法的、唯一的比特币地址。
比特币钱包主要分为热钱包和冷钱包,而这两种钱包在生成算法上存在一定的差异。热钱包通常是在线钱包,方便快捷,但相对安全性较低;冷钱包则是离线存储,安全性高,但使用上相对不便。冷钱包的生成算法多采用更为复杂的加密方法,而热钱包则可能更多依赖于对称加密。
钱包生成算法通常通过伪随机数生成器(PRNG)产生具有高度随机性的私钥。生成的私钥可导出相应的公钥和比特币地址。私钥的安全性和随机性对比特币的整体安全性至关重要。除了常规的随机数生成之外,现代比特币钱包还使用了包括 BIP32、BIP39 和 BIP44 等改进提案来进一步增强钱包生成算法的随机性和系统性。
虽然比特币的钱包生成算法设计上考虑了安全性,但仍然存在一些潜在的安全隐患。例如,若用户的随机数生成器被攻破,黑客可能会轻易获取私钥。此外,若用户将其私钥保存在不安全的环境中,也可能导致资产被盗。所以,了解这些生成算法的背后技术,可以帮助用户更好地保护自己的数字资产。
选择合适的钱包生成算法不仅依赖于用户的使用需求,也与安全等级要求密切相关。对于普通用户来说,选择一个知名且可靠的钱包软件,使用标准的生成算法已能满足日常交易的需要。对于高价值资产的持有者,则建议使用冷钱包,保证私钥的绝对安全。
随着区块链技术的不断发展,比特币钱包生成算法也在不断演变。未来有可能出现更加安全、更高效的算法,以提高比特币地址的生成速度与扩展性。同时,随着量子计算技术的逐渐兴起,钱包生成算法的安全性也将面对新的挑战,因此不断更新与发展算法变得尤为重要。
比特币钱包是一种软件程序,用于存储和管理比特币。它可以生成比特币地址,并且为在区块链上执行交易提供必要的私钥交易权限。用户通过比特币钱包可以发送、接收和管理比特币资产。
生成比特币钱包一般通过渲染密码来生成随机私钥,用户可以使用特定的钱包应用程序或工具,这些应用程序会自动生成钱包及相应地址,并显示公钥及私钥。
比特币钱包的安全性分为多个层面,包括私钥存储安全、网络安全、应用程序安全等。用户需确保所使用的钱包软件及其生成算法具有良好的安全性,否则可能面临资产盗窃风险。
热钱包是指连接互联网的数字钱包,通常用于频繁交易,使用方便但安全性较低;冷钱包则是指不连接互联网的钱包,拥有更高的安全性,适合长久保存资产,但使用上相对较为麻烦。
钱包生成算法的安全性在于其算法的复杂性与生成随机数的质量。理论上,只要生成过程符合加密标准,且随机数生成器足够复杂,破解概率极低。但若使用弱密码或常见方法,攻击者仍有可能得逞。
私钥是比特币钱包的关键所在,必须妥善保存。建议使用硬件钱包、冷存储或耐用的纸质钱包保存私钥,同时避免将其保存在网络上或可接触到的地方,以降低被盗风险。
总字数:3700字 希望这份关于比特币钱包生成算法的内容,对你的需求有所帮助!